Update! Atlanta Police Confirm Kevin Samuels Had Chest Pain, Reported By A Woman He “Met The Night Before”

Rumors swirled on Thursday about the death of ‘relationship guru’ Kevin Samuels most of us not knowing what to believe because so much was unconfirmed.
On Friday according to the Huffington Post the Atlanta Police provided more details surrounding his passing.
They shared the below points on Twitter:
– A woman met Samuels and spent the night with him. She ID’d him as Kevin Samuels.
– Samuels complained of chest pain, fell on top of her, and she called 911.
– Officials performed CPR, he was unresponsive
According to the police report Samuels was with Ortencia Alcantara, a woman he met the night prior and who had spent the night with the ‘guru’.
In the morning Kevin started to complain about chest pain and fell on top of the woman as she was assisting him.
She also reportedly asked police to contact the front desk for a defibrillator to keep Kevin responsive.
(She is a nurse).
This is the report from the police
His mother Beverly Samuels-Burch, declined to release details about what happened.
But she did say she learned of her son’s death from social media.
“That was a terrible thing for social media to put that out. I didn’t even know. I hadn’t even been notified,” she said in a phone call on Friday. “All I’m doing is requesting that people pray for us.”
